Cappadocia - Ariarates V Eusebes Philopator 163-130 B.C.
Av: Head of the ruler to the right, Rw: Athena with Nike standing on her right hand, in her left hand a spear and shield, below a monogram, on the right the inscription BAΣIΛEΩΣ, on the left ΑΡΙΑΡΑΔΟΥ, in the center ΕΥΣΕΒΟΥΖ, in segment Λ
silver, 17.8 mm, 4.05 g
